On 05/02/21 12:51 pm, Christophe Leroy wrote:
Please provide some description of the change.

And please clarify the patch subject, because as far as I can see, the return is already checked allthough the check seams wrong.
This was my first patch. I will try to provide better description of changes and subject in later patches.

diff --git a/arch/powerpc/kernel/eeh.c b/arch/powerpc/kernel/eeh.c
index 813713c9120c..2dbe1558a71f 100644
--- a/arch/powerpc/kernel/eeh.c
+++ b/arch/powerpc/kernel/eeh.c
@@ -1628,8 +1628,8 @@ static ssize_t eeh_force_recover_write(struct file *filp,
      char buf[20];
      int ret;
  -    ret = simple_write_to_buffer(buf, sizeof(buf), ppos, user_buf, count);
-    if (!ret)
+    ret = simple_write_to_buffer(buf, sizeof(buf)-1, ppos, user_buf, count);
+    if (ret <= 0) >           return -EFAULT;
Why return -EFAULT when the function has returned -EINVAL ?
If -EINVAL is returned by simple_write_to_buffer, we should return -EINVAL.
And why is it -EFAULT when ret is 0 ? EFAULT means error accessing memory.
The earlier check returned EFAULT when ret is 0. Most probably, there was an assumption
that writing 0 bytes (by simple_write_to_buffer) means a fault with memory (or error accessing memory).
